Transaction 607265eb73bbdc21856b72f7cd797b544ae9bed172fde015e4f5d0fc3c0207b5
1 Input
1 Output
-
607265eb73bbdc21856b72f7cd797b544ae9bed172fde015e4f5d0fc3c0207b5:0
- value
- 45041392
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0b28d5f5a1d675a284b09f09e42cba541e77405
- address
- bc1q6zeg6h66r4n452ztp8cfuskt54q7waq93df7fk